Yousef was studying to be a psychoanalyst, he was a promising writer and a talented photographer. In January 2023, he published an essay titled “Who will pay for the 20 years we lost?” for the “We Are Not Numbers” collective. In this essay, he recounts the destruction of his family’s orchard by an Israeli missile strike in May 2022. Yousef was also a contributing writer for Palestine Chronicle and this is his last article “Kidney Transplant and Rebirth: A Palestinian Love Story”. His desire to explore cities within Palestine surpassed that of well-known destinations like Paris or the Maldives Islands.
14/10/2023, Beit Lahiya, at the age of 20 years
Killed in an Israeli missile strike on his family’s home in the northern town of Beit Lahia, located in the Gaza Strip north of Jabalia.
